Mid-State Technical College, in partnership with the Wisconsin Rapids Rafters, is bringing back the Rafters Meet-and-Greet & Cuts 4 Kids event. The free event will be held on Wednesday, June 11, on Mid-State’s Wisconsin Rapids Campus and is open to the public. Attendees are welcome to stop by the event between 4:30 and 7 p.m. Rafters Meet-and-Greet & Cuts 4 Kids will feature free games, activities, food and kids’ haircuts. Wisconsin Rapids, WI – The Wisconsin Rapids Rafters, a member of the Northwoods League, are thrilled to announce their highly anticipated 2024 season schedule. The 15th Wisconsin Rapids Rafters season will kick off on May 27th with an away game against the Fond du Lac Dock Spiders, followed by Opening Day at Witter Field on May 28th, featuring a showdown against the Dock Spiders with the first pitch scheduled for 6:35 PM.
